Executive Summary

Medpace, Inc. obtained a default judgment against Agenus Inc. and Garo H. Armen in a breach-of-contract and breach-of-fiduciary-duty lawsuit after the defendants failed to comply with discovery obligations and did not oppose the sanctions motion. The court struck defendants' answers and granted default judgment, with Medpace to file a proposed judgment by December 10, 2025. This removes litigation uncertainty for Medpace and positions it to recover damages, though the amount has not yet been determined.

Key Facts

  • Medpace sued Agenus Inc. and Garo H. Armen for breach of contract and breach of fiduciary duty.
  • Defendants engaged in 'wholesale noncompliance' with discovery obligations and failed to oppose the sanctions motion.
  • Court granted default judgment, striking defendants' answers, on December 4, 2025.
  • Medpace must file a proposed judgment by December 10, 2025; damages amount not yet specified in the opinion.
  • The ruling is a final judgment on liability, with damages to be determined.
